From 61e9eab02b4c5fd5b28a968552d331f0f35a1271 Mon Sep 17 00:00:00 2001 From: Sebastian Serth Date: Mon, 19 Apr 2021 18:23:34 +0200 Subject: [PATCH] Load Prometheus if enabled and not in console --- config/initializers/prometheus.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/config/initializers/prometheus.rb b/config/initializers/prometheus.rb index 276a694f..8abe5ec9 100644 --- a/config/initializers/prometheus.rb +++ b/config/initializers/prometheus.rb @@ -1,6 +1,6 @@ # frozen_string_literal: true -return unless CodeOcean::Config.new(:code_ocean).read[:prometheus_exporter][:enabled] && defined?(::Rails::Server) +return unless CodeOcean::Config.new(:code_ocean).read[:prometheus_exporter][:enabled] && !defined?(::Rails::Console) return if %w[db: assets:].any? { |task| Rake.application.top_level_tasks.to_s.include?(task) } # Add metric callbacks to all models